java - 面试题:Dubbo中zookeeper做注册中心,如果注册中心集群都挂掉,发布者和订阅者之间还能通信么?
PHP中文网
PHP中文网 2017-04-18 09:45:10
0
5
861

如题:Dubbo中zookeeper做注册中心,如果注册中心集群都挂掉,发布者和订阅者之间还能通信么?

================================================================================
可以的,启动dubbo时,消费者会从zk拉取注册的生产者的地址接口等数据,缓存在本地。每次调用时,按照本地存储的地址进行调用

PHP中文网
PHP中文网

认证高级PHP讲师

répondre à tous(5)
PHPzhong

Oui, vous pouvez jeter un œil à la documentation, qui explique ceci :

刘奇

Oui, le consommateur dispose d'une liste de producteurs localement. Il continuera à travailler selon la liste. Cependant, il est impossible de synchroniser la dernière liste de services depuis le centre d'inscription. Ce n'est pas grave si le centre d'inscription raccroche. à court terme, mais il faut le réparer au plus vite

阿神

Peu importe si cela raccroche, mais le principe est que vous n'avez pas ajouté de nouveaux services. Si vous souhaitez appeler de nouveaux services, vous ne pouvez pas le faire

.
小葫芦

Oui, lorsque dubbo est démarré, le consommateur extraira l'interface d'adresse du producteur enregistré et d'autres données de zk et les mettra en cache localement. Chaque fois qu'il est appelé, il est appelé en fonction de l'adresse stockée localement

左手右手慢动作

Oui, le document dit que l'adresse de correspondance sera mise en cache

Derniers téléchargements
Plus>
effets Web
Code source du site Web
Matériel du site Web
Modèle frontal
À propos de nous Clause de non-responsabilité Sitemap
Site Web PHP chinois:Formation PHP en ligne sur le bien-être public,Aidez les apprenants PHP à grandir rapidement!